ホームページ > PHPフレームワーク > Laravel > LaravelがCSSスタイルをロードできない問題を解決する方法

LaravelがCSSスタイルをロードできない問題を解決する方法

PHPz
リリース: 2024-03-10 09:12:03
オリジナル
974 人が閲覧しました

LaravelがCSSスタイルをロードできない問題を解決する方法

タイトル: Laravel が CSS スタイルを読み込めない問題を解決する方法

Laravel を Web 開発に使用する過程で、CSS スタイルがロードできない状況に遭遇することがあります。を読み込むことができず、ページが異常に表示される可能性があります。この記事では、いくつかの一般的な原因と解決策を紹介し、参考として具体的なコード例を示します。

1. CSS ファイルのパスが正しいかどうかを確認してください

まず、CSS ファイルのパスが正しいことを確認します。通常、Laravel プロジェクトでは、CSS ファイルは次の css フォルダーに配置されます。パブリックディレクトリ。 CSS ファイルをブレード テンプレートに導入する場合は、asset() 関数を使用して正しい URL を生成し、CSS ファイルをロードする必要があります。例は次のとおりです:

<link rel="stylesheet" href="{{ asset('css/style.css') }}">
ログイン後にコピー
ログイン後にコピー

2. CSS ファイルが存在するかどうかを確認します

CSS ファイルが誤って削除されたり、パスが間違っているために、CSS ファイルの読み込みに失敗する場合があります。 CSS ファイルが正常に読み込まれたかどうかは、ブラウザの開発者ツールの [ネットワーク] タブで確認できます。404 エラーが表示された場合は、パスを確認するか、CSS ファイルを再アップロードする必要があります。

3. パブリック ディレクトリに読み取り権限があるか確認します

パブリック ディレクトリに読み取り権限がない場合、CSS ファイルを読み込むことができません。ターミナルから次のコマンドを実行して、パブリック ディレクトリに正しいアクセス許可設定があることを確認できます:

chmod -R 755 public
ログイン後にコピー

4.asset() 関数を使用して CSS ファイルをロードします

Laravel では、正しい URL が確実に生成されるように、asset() 関数を使用して CSS ファイルをロードするのが最善です。例は次のとおりです:

<link rel="stylesheet" href="{{ asset('css/style.css') }}">
ログイン後にコピー
ログイン後にコピー

5. キャッシュのクリア

キャッシュの問題により、ページが正しく表示されない場合があります。ブラウザのキャッシュをクリアしてみるか、次のコマンドを実行してクリアしてください。 Laravel キャッシュ:

php artisan cache:clear
ログイン後にコピー

上記の方法により、Laravel が CSS スタイルを読み込めない問題を解決し、Web サイトが正常に表示されるようにすることができます。上記の内容が皆様のお役に立てれば幸いです。

以上がLaravelがCSSスタイルをロードできない問題を解決する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

関連ラベル:
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
最新の問題
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ート